About Philip Sharman
A skilled and professional executive/non-executive director (ED/NED) in the low-carbon energy sector with proven success in: developing, implementing and leading strategies; external fundraising; technology collaborations; and other methodologies needed to create and nurture successful businesses. Forty years of international experience at the interface of industry, academia and government, including for a global OEM, a UK plc, an SME start-up, three Russell Group universities and UK government.Established Evenlode Associates Ltd in 2011 as vehicle to undertake a portfolio of ED, NED, interim and advisory appointments and contract/consultancy assignments.Joined Alstom Power in 2008 and was Director of Technology External Affairs, reporting to Alstom’s Senior Vice-President of Technology from 2009 until 2011. Prior to joining Alstom, Philip had gained over 25 years experience in the low-carbon energy sector both in the private and public sector. For much of this time, he worked as a consultant to the UK government on various energy-related R&D and technology transfer programmes, including setting-up and managing both the UK’s Cleaner Coal Technology Programme (for 10 years) and the UK’s Advanced Fuel Cells R&D Programme. From 2001, he focused on technology transfer programmes, addressing low-carbon energy technologies with North America for the UK Department of Trade and Industry (DTI) and as an R&D Specialist for UK Trade and Investment (UKTI). Philip has considerable international consulting and technology transfer experience in North America, Central & Eastern Europe, China, Japan and South Africa.Specialties: Low-carbon energy technologies (clean coal, CCS, renewables, fuel cells, hydrogen energy, energy storage, nuclear fission, nuclear fusion, energy efficiency); R&D project/programme management; fundraising for R&D; governance of R&D organisations.
